WebThe EPC provides data connectivity to external networks such as the Internet. 3GPP TS 29.244 Release 14 introduced CUPS, which stands for Control and User Plane Separation. CUPS provides the architecture enhancements for the separation of functionality in the EPC’s serving gateway (SGW) and PDN gateway (PGW). WebJun 9, 2024 · Furthermore, 3GPP has specified N32 to be considered as two separate interfaces: N32-c and N32-f. N32-c is the Control Plane interface between the SEPPs for performing the initial handshake and negotiating the parameters to be applied for the actual N32 message forwarding. See section 4.2.2 of 3GPP TS 29.573.

WebAug 16, 2024 · 4G Control and User Plane Separation (CUPS) EPC The separation of Control and User Plane for the 4G architecture was introduced with 3GPP Release 14. CUPS stands for C ontrol and U ser P lane S eparation of EPC nodes and provides the architecture enhancements for the separation of functionality in the Evolved Packet Core’s SGW, … WebOct 27, 2024 · Control and User Plane Separation of EPC nodes (CUPS) is one of the main Work Items of 3GPP Release 14. CUPS separate control & user plane from S-GW, P-GW & TDF. TDF is Traffic Detection Function that was introduced together with the Sd reference point as means for traffic management in Release 11.
